the cost of 12 hot dogs and 8 fry portions is £52. The cost of 8 hot dogs and 12 fry portions is £48. What is the total cost of a hot dog and a portion of fries?

Answers

Answer:

Hot dogs cost £3 and fry's cost £2.

Total cost £5.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let a hot dog cost £x and a portion of fry's cost £y.

Then:

12x + 8y = 52

8x + 12y = 48

Simplifying these 2 equations we get:

3x + 2y = 13 ---------- (A)

2x + 3y = 12...............(B)

multiply the first equation by 2 and the second by 3:

6x + 4y = 26  

6x + 9y = 36

Subtracting:

0 - 5y = -10

y = -10/-5 = 2.

Now, substituting in equation  (A):

3x + 2(2) = 13

3x = 9

x = 3.

The cost of 5 gallons of ice cream has a variance of 64 with a mean of 34 dollars during the summer.

What is the probability that the sample mean would differ from the true mean by less than 1.1 dollars if a sample of 38 5-gallon pails is randomly selected? Round your answer to four decimal places.

Answers

The probability is [(X - μ) < 1.1] = 0.6046.

What is probability ?

A probability is a numerical representation of the likelihood or chance that a specific event will take place. Both proportions ranging from 0 to 1 and percentages ranging from 0% to 100% can be used to describe probabilities.

Given: σ² = 64

Mean μ = 34

To find: Probability[(X - μ) < 1.1]

Computation:  Standard deviation σ = √σ²

Standard deviation σ = √64

Standard deviation σ = 8

Probability[(X - μ) < 1.1] = Probability[-1.1 < (X - μ) < 1.1]

Probability[(X - μ) < 1.1] = Probability[-1.1/(8/√38) < (X - μ) < 1.1/(8/√38)]

Using z table

The probability =  [(X - μ) < 1.1] = 0.6046.

I am doing principle rate and time and trying to figure out how to find out what the missing number is whether it be rate time or principle

Answers

Generally, the equation representing the simple interest on a deposited amount is;

[tex]I\text{ = }\frac{PRT}{100}[/tex]

where ;

I is the simple interest

R is the rate

T is the time

We have other varaints of this formula, depending on the term missing

All we have to is to make the missing term the subject of the equation and input the other given values to get the missing term

We can have the variants of this formula as follows

a) Missing Principal

[tex]P\text{ = }\frac{100I}{RT}[/tex]

b) Missing Rate

[tex]R\text{ = }\frac{100I}{PT}[/tex]

c) Missing Time

[tex]T\text{ = }\frac{100I}{PR}[/tex]
